Dogwood Tree Removal in Allentown, PA
Dogwood tree removal services involve the careful removal of dogwood trees that are dead, diseased, damaged, or pose a risk to surrounding structures or landscape. These projects often include removing entire trees or selectively pruning branches to improve safety and property aesthetics. Homeowners typically request this service to prevent potential hazards, create space for new landscaping, or address issues caused by pests or disease. Before requesting removal, property owners should consider the size and location of the tree, potential impact on nearby structures or utilities, and whether any permits are required for the work.
Understanding the scope of dogwood tree removal is essential for property owners to plan effectively. It’s important to communicate details such as the tree’s condition, accessibility, and any nearby plants or structures that could be affected. Clarifying whether the project involves complete removal or partial pruning helps ensure expectations are aligned. Additionally, knowing about any local regulations or restrictions related to tree removal can help facilitate a smooth process. Proper assessment and planning can contribute to a safe and efficient removal, supporting the health and safety of the property.

Dogwood Tree Removal Questions
When is it necessary to remove a Dogwood tree? Removal may be needed if the tree is diseased, damaged, or poses a safety risk to the property.
What signs indicate a Dogwood tree should be removed? Symptoms include extensive decay, dead branches, or structural instability.
How does the removal process typically work? The process involves safely cutting down the tree and removing debris to restore the landscape.
Are there any considerations before removing a Dogwood tree? It's important to assess the tree’s location and potential impact on surrounding plants or structures.
